Transaction 74f62d2a98122f32a2ed0dcb21fd79df40f202c2374c8a80c1cd2afddaf0264d

1 Input
2 Outputs
  • 74f62d2a98122f32a2ed0dcb21fd79df40f202c2374c8a80c1cd2afddaf0264d:0
  • value  1085173
    address  34UEoG3Lc16LVdLcXwEgbAo3hLCrAymopZ
  • 74f62d2a98122f32a2ed0dcb21fd79df40f202c2374c8a80c1cd2afddaf0264d:1
  • value  1186439
    address  3NKxVBLFJbgVJYagbDiJeMgPr4rkDSS2eK